news 2026/5/26 23:03:01

Happy Island Designer:打造梦幻岛屿的完整设计指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Happy Island Designer:打造梦幻岛屿的完整设计指南

在数字创意的广阔天地中,岛屿设计工具为创意表达提供了全新的维度。Happy Island Designer作为一款专业的岛屿规划软件,将复杂的景观设计简化为直观的操作界面,让每位用户都能轻松构建属于自己的虚拟乐园。

【免费下载链接】HappyIslandDesigner"Happy Island Designer (Alpha)",是一个在线工具,它允许用户设计和定制自己的岛屿。这个工具是受游戏《动物森友会》(Animal Crossing)启发而创建的,游戏中玩家可以自定义自己的岛屿。项目地址: https://gitcode.com/gh_mirrors/ha/HappyIslandDesigner

设计理念与核心功能架构

Happy Island Designer的核心价值在于将专业级的地形规划工具平民化。基于Paper.js技术架构,该工具实现了从基础地形绘制到复杂建筑布局的全流程覆盖。软件采用模块化设计,将功能划分为工具操作、资源管理和设计展示三大板块。

设计工作台采用左侧垂直工具栏与中央编辑区的经典布局。工具栏包含画笔绘制、建筑放置、颜色选择等核心功能模块,每个图标都经过精心设计,确保用户能够快速理解其功能含义。中央编辑区配备精确的网格坐标系统,支持像素级的地形编辑和元素定位。

实战操作流程详解

要开始你的岛屿设计之旅,首先需要搭建本地开发环境。通过以下步骤完成项目部署:

git clone https://gitcode.com/gh_mirrors/ha/HappyIslandDesigner cd HappyIslandDesigner npm install npm start

完成部署后,访问本地服务器即可进入设计界面。操作流程遵循从整体规划到细节完善的逻辑顺序:

地形基础构建阶段

  • 使用画笔工具绘制岛屿轮廓,通过颜色选择器定义不同地形区域
  • 借助网格系统精确控制建筑和道路的位置
  • 利用水系工具创建河流和湖泊,丰富地形层次

功能元素布局阶段

  • 从sprite资源库中选择合适的建筑模型
  • 在植被分类中挑选树木和花卉进行装饰
  • 设置交通网络,包括桥梁、道路和空港位置

细节优化与调整阶段

  • 微调颜色搭配,确保整体视觉和谐
  • 检查功能区域连通性,优化用户体验
  • 利用预览功能检验设计效果

进阶功能探索与应用

对于希望深度定制设计体验的用户,Happy Island Designer提供了丰富的扩展可能性。软件支持自定义资源导入,用户可以将个人设计的建筑模型和装饰元素添加到项目中。

技术架构层面,项目采用TypeScript开发,确保代码的健壮性和可维护性。核心模块包括:

  • app/components/:用户界面组件库
  • app/tools/:功能工具实现
  • static/sprite/:图形资源文件

通过分析docs目录中的技术文档,开发者可以深入了解项目的内部实现机制,为二次开发奠定基础。

设计成果展示与分享

完成岛屿设计后,用户可以将作品导出为多种格式。软件内置的截图功能支持高分辨率输出,确保设计细节的完美呈现。导出的图像中包含了完整的岛屿数据信息,便于后续的修改和优化。

在实际应用中,用户可以根据不同场景需求创建多样化的岛屿主题。从宁静的度假胜地到繁华的都市岛屿,设计工具提供了充分的创作自由度。

成功的设计案例往往具备以下特征:合理的功能分区、和谐的视觉搭配、流畅的交通网络。这些成功要素的结合,能够创造出既美观又实用的岛屿设计方案。

通过掌握Happy Island Designer的各项功能特性,用户能够将创意构想转化为具体的数字作品。无论是游戏场景搭建还是虚拟环境设计,这款工具都能提供专业级的支持。开始你的设计之旅,探索无限创意可能。

【免费下载链接】HappyIslandDesigner"Happy Island Designer (Alpha)",是一个在线工具,它允许用户设计和定制自己的岛屿。这个工具是受游戏《动物森友会》(Animal Crossing)启发而创建的,游戏中玩家可以自定义自己的岛屿。项目地址: https://gitcode.com/gh_mirrors/ha/HappyIslandDesigner

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/20 12:11:25

7种字重免费商用字体深度解析:思源宋体完整使用手册

7种字重免费商用字体深度解析:思源宋体完整使用手册 【免费下载链接】source-han-serif-ttf Source Han Serif TTF 项目地址: https://gitcode.com/gh_mirrors/so/source-han-serif-ttf 还在为商业设计项目寻找既专业又无需担心版权问题的中文字体吗&#xf…

作者头像 李华
网站建设 2026/5/21 14:29:33

GPT-SoVITS语音风格迁移潜力分析

GPT-SoVITS语音风格迁移潜力分析 在短视频、虚拟主播和个性化内容爆发的今天,人们不再满足于千篇一律的“机器音”。我们期待听到更自然、更有情感、甚至带有个人印记的声音——比如用自己说话的方式读出一段外语,或是让AI以偶像的声线朗读一封情书。这种…

作者头像 李华
网站建设 2026/5/20 21:50:35

78、卷积码相关知识详解

卷积码相关知识详解 1. 卷积码基础 在卷积码中,定义了一个具有无限行和列的二进制矩阵 $B(G)$: [ B(G) = \begin{bmatrix} B_0 \ B_1 \ B_2 \ \cdots \ B_M \ B_0 \ B_1 \ B_2 \ \cdots \ B_M \ B_0 \ B_1 \ B_2 \ \cdots \ B_M \ \cdots \ \cdots \ …

作者头像 李华
网站建设 2026/5/22 0:21:47

智能定位突破:企业微信远程打卡的4大核心解决方案

智能定位突破:企业微信远程打卡的4大核心解决方案 【免费下载链接】weworkhook 企业微信打卡助手,在Android设备上安装Xposed后hook企业微信获取GPS的参数达到修改定位的目的。注意运行环境仅支持Android设备且已经ROOTXposed框架 (未 ROOT 设…

作者头像 李华
网站建设 2026/5/26 5:39:11

81、二元卷积码的软判决解码算法

二元卷积码的软判决解码算法 1. 双向 APP 解码算法 1.1 算法概述 双向后验概率(APP)解码是一种用于二元卷积码的软判决解码算法。该算法在每个时间点计算消息符号为 0 的概率,基于接收到的向量和信道概率。这些概率可用于两个方面:一是解码器据此决定消息符号是 0 还是 …

作者头像 李华
网站建设 2026/5/26 11:05:50

MIPI D-PHY 理解

文章目录1. 背景2. 概念介绍2.1 HS 模式 和 LP 模式2.2 连续模式时钟和非连续模式时钟3. 长短包3.1 数据格式3.2 数据类型 (DI)4. 波形图示1. 背景 嵌入式领域中,很多高速、大数据通常都会使用mipi接口进行传输,如sensor、毫米波雷…

作者头像 李华